Jackie Shipp
 Jackie Shipp
Position:
Defensive Line Coach

Experience:
9th Year at OU

The Jackie Shipp File
Birthdate: March 19, 1962
Hometown: Stillwater, Okla.
High School: Donart, 1980
College: University of Oklahoma, 1980-83; Langston University, 1992

Coaching History

  • 1999-present - Oklahoma Defensive Line Coach
  • 1998 - Alabama Defensive Line Coach
  • 1997 - Northeast Louisiana Defensive Line Coach
  • 1996-1997 - Minnesota Vikings Coaching Intern
  • 1995 - Green Bay Packers Coaching Intern
  • 1994-1996 - Southern Illinois Defensive Line Coach
  • 1993 - Tennessee-Martin Defensive Line Coach
  • 1992 - Central Missouri State Defensive Line Coach
  • 1991 - Langston Linebackers Coach

    Coaching Accomplishments

  • Two of his players earned All-Big 12 honors in 2001, including Tommie Harris who was called by many the top freshman defensive lineman in the nation.
  • In 2000, he had four defensive linemen selected to All-Big 12 teams including first-team selection Ryan Fisher.

    Player Accomplishments

  • A first-round pick (14th overall) of the Miami Dolphins where he played five seasons. He helped the Dolphins post a 48-31 record, make two playoff appearances and advance to the 1985 Super Bowl. Shipp was the Dolphins' leading tackler (79) in 1987 and finished his career in Miami with 231 tackles.
  • Played one season with the Los Angeles Raiders (1988).
  • A standout linebacker at the University of Oklahoma, he starred on Sooner squads that posted a combined 33-14-1 record, won two bowl games and captured the 1980 Big Eight Championship.
  • Earned all-conference honors as a junior and senior, and was selected as an All-American by Football News following his junior campaign.
  • In the 1982 border clash with Texas, Shipp was a one-man wrecking crew with 21 tackles, just three shy of the OU single-game total record.
  • Totaled 477 total tackles in his career which stands second on the OU list for career tackles. Also owns the single-season record for tackles (182) during his sophomore campaign in 1981.
